FIELD SERVICE AND COMMUNICATIONS TECHNICIAN (Equipment Systems Specialist-Foundation)

Posting Number:
VA1008

Primary Duties:
Under direct supervision, incumbent works as a member of a team that provides voice and data network support to the campus community. Responsible for varying levels of field service work to include the installation, termination and testing of new structured cabling systems and the troubleshooting and repair of the existing physical infrastructure. Also responsible for varying levels of maintenance and repair of campus communications systems. Systems include but are not limited to the campus voice system, standard analog telephones, and local and wide area networking components.

Required Education:

The prerequisite foundation of knowledge and skills in technical systems and equipment would normally be obtained through an associate of arts degree in electronics, telecommunications, or industrial technology or equivalent education, training, and/or directly related experience.

P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S:
Incumbent/applicant will need to be able to perform the essential job functions (duties) of this position with or without reasonable accommodation. This position alternates between remaining in a stationary position operating a personal computer for long periods of time and frequently moving about inside the office. Must be able to travel across campus to other offices and buildings for meetings and events.

WORK ENVIRONMENT:
Work is performed in dirty environments, confined spaces, and above ceilings is sometimes required. Incumbent is required to climb up and down ladders, crawl under desks, and through crawl spaces Work is also performed in a typical office environment operating standard office equipment.
